DP117 | THE TREATMENT OF TRANSPLANT ELIGIBLE PRIMARY PLASMA CELL LEUKEMIA PATIENTS: AN ITALIAN REAL-LIFE STUDY
Primary plasma cell leukemia (pPCL) is a rare variant of plasma cell malignancy characterized by at least 5% circulating plasma cell (cPC), aggressive behavior and ominous prognosis.
